Skip to content
  • Hidde Beydals's avatar
    kustomize: use FS from `fluxcd/pkg` · 57442e8f
    Hidde Beydals authored
    
    
    This switches to a secure FS implementation in most places, except for
    where we can not make changes at this moment because it would break
    behavior.
    
    Not handled in this commit:
    
    - Allowing the root for `manifestgen` packages to be configured.
    - Allowing the user to define a working root while building locally.
    - Defaulting to the secure FS implementation in
      `kustomization.MakeDefaultOptions`. Problem here is that constructing
      the secure FS could result in an error, which we can not surface
      without signature changes to the constructor func.
    
    Signed-off-by: default avatarHidde Beydals <hello@hidde.co>
    57442e8f
Loading